Name: Vadito topographic map, elevation, terrain.

Location: Vadito, Taos County, New Mexico, 87579, United States (36.18566 -105.68729 36.20256 -105.66257)

Average elevation: 7,664 ft

Minimum elevation: 7,388 ft

Maximum elevation: 8,186 ft

Wheeler Peak

United States > New Mexico > Taos County

Wheeler Peak is the highest natural point in the U.S. state of New Mexico. It is located northeast of Taos and south of Red River in the northern part of the state, and just 2 miles (3.2 km) southeast of the ski slopes of Taos Ski Valley.
